Output 3937593a49a06f6eb48b32acf47fe442cabc034d867e258dbdb924b5fcbde48d:1

value
10521607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4c0c04c2e8ab75f1391db05713645ee8a14b0b OP_EQUAL
address
3EUqdEZLZ4nauTY4kU6uuum5ytJsod2iZV
transaction
3937593a49a06f6eb48b32acf47fe442cabc034d867e258dbdb924b5fcbde48d